Wenceslaus Hollar's "Three Children's Heads" (1645) is a masterful example of the artist's detailed etching style. The three heads are presented in profile, their delicate features rendered with remarkable precision. Hollar's use of light and shadow creates a sense of depth and volume, bringing the children's faces to life on the page. This drawing showcases Hollar's skill in capturing the essence of his subjects with meticulous detail, reflecting the artistic trends of the 17th century. The artwork is currently on display at the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York City.
